Breaking: Green Party Denies Supporting Demola Adeleke, Says CNPP Lied
The Green Party of Nigeria (GPN) has denied supporting the cand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), Mr Ademola Adeleke, for the Osun West Senatorial District by-election, coming up on July 8.
Chairman of the GPN in Osun State, Alhaji Rafiu Anifowose in a press statement on Monday said his party at state and national level does not support Adeleke as being reported.
The Conference of All Nigerian Political Parties (CNPP) had said on Sunday that 10 political parties, among which were GPN, had adopted Adeleke as their candidate for the election.
But Anifowose faulted the CNPP claim, describing it as untrue, fraudulent and an attempt to malign the credible image of the party.
According to Anifowose, the GPN does not belong to CNPP which he described an umbrella of political marauders.
He urged the general public to dismiss the report as it is the imagination of the CNPP and the PDP which are looking for credible parties to sell their candidate.
